Venue | Maharashtra Cricket Association Stadium, Gahunje on 20th April 2018 (20-over match) |
Balls per over | 6 |
Toss | Rajasthan Royals won the toss and decided to field |
Result | Chennai Super Kings won by 64 runs |
Points | Chennai Super Kings 2; Rajasthan Royals 0 |
Umpires | KN Ananthapadmanabhan, NN Menon |
TV umpire | RJ Tucker (Australia) |
Referee | J Srinath |
Reserve Umpire | NW Pandit |
Player of the Match | SR Watson |

Notes
--> Chennai Super Kings powerplay 1: overs 1 to 6 (69/1)
--> Rajasthan Royals powerplay 1: overs 1 to 6 (35/3)
--> Chennai Super Kings innings: 50 in 4.2 overs
--> Chennai Super Kings innings: 100 in 9.5 overs
--> Chennai Super Kings innings: 150 in 12.6 overs
--> Chennai Super Kings innings: 200 in 19.3 overs
--> Rajasthan Royals innings: 50 in 7.5 overs
--> Rajasthan Royals innings: 100 in 12.6 overs
--> H Klaasen made his debut in Indian Premier League matches
--> SR Watson 50 in 28 balls with 3 fours and 4 sixes
--> SR Watson 100 in 51 balls with 9 fours and 6 sixes
--> SR Watson passed his previous highest score of 104 in Indian Premier League matches
--> KV Sharma made his debut for Chennai Super Kings in Indian Premier League matches
--> KV Sharma made his debut for Chennai Super Kings in Twenty20 matches
--> H Klaasen made his debut for Rajasthan Royals in Twenty20 matches
--> H Klaasen made his debut in India in Twenty20 matches
--> R Shreyas Gopal achieved his best innings bowling analysis in Twenty20 matches when he dismissed SW Billings in the Chennai Super Kings innings (previous best was 2-15)
--> R Shreyas Gopal achieved his best innings bowling analysis in Indian Premier League matches when he dismissed SW Billings in the Chennai Super Kings innings (previous best was 2-22)
--> KV Sharma reached 50 wickets in Indian Premier League matches when he dismissed JD Unadkat, his 1st wicket in the Rajasthan Royals innings
--> SR Watson (37) and AT Rayudu (12) added 50 in 27 balls for the Chennai Super Kings 1st wicket
--> SR Watson (25) and SK Raina (28) added 50 in 32 balls for the Chennai Super Kings 2nd wicket
